Q&A with HERM EDWARDS - 8/7
Aug 07, 2006, 1:02:36 PM

Herm Edwards Day 11 - Windows Media | Real Video


TRAINING CAMP

HERM EDWARDS: “It was a little sluggish early which I anticipated when you give them a night off. But I thought the last couple of periods the tempo picked up.

“We’re starting to move some young guys into the first group and I think that’s important. I think they’ve earned the opportunity to go with the first group. Obviously, if you watched practice they’re playing different positions. For the most part, there are some young guys that have been here who have an opportunity to play a lot of football for us, and I think what you have to do is put them in position to go with the first group at times to see if they can handle it. That’s kind of how we’ll handle it in the pre-season, too.

“Young guys will play. Veteran guys will play a certain amount of plays this week. I’ve always done it that way. Certain guys you’re going to protect, but at the end of the day we’ll make sure that our veteran guys who are going to start for us will have enough time in the pre-season so there will be ready for the opener.”

Q: You have Ryan Sims in a rotation and now I’ve noticed the last few days that he’s been second team or third team. What’s going on with him?

EDWARDS: “Nothing. He’s doing a good job of competing every day. He’s realizing that he needs to be a consistent player for us. There are certain things we’re asking these guys to do and if they don’t do them obviously we’re not getting to them and that’s important to do.

“But for the most part, any coach is always looking for consistency from his players. I think Ryan is working on that, but he’s not working with the first team as much as he was earlier in camp. But he hasn’t quit working and that’s probably the most important thing: don’t quit working. There’s no starting roster at this point. You have to understand that. That’s what training camp is about: it’s about competing.”

Q: So he’s not getting the consistency that you would like?

EDWARDS: “No, he is, at times. We have real high expectations for him, and there’s a certain standard we want him to play at. We’re going to try and help him do that and he’s putting forth a good effort to do that.”

Q: Ideally, you don’t want him running down with anything but the first team do you?

EDWARDS: “For the defensive line — probably at the end of the day when the season kicks off – there are going to be six guys that are running on the first team. You’ve got to understand that because we’re going to rotate these guys. They’re not going to play 60 plays. It’s impossible for them given what we’re asking them to do. We’re asking our guys to run. Our defensive line is almost like linebackers. We’re asking them to make plays if the ball is anywhere inside the numbers, they’ve got to go run and pursue and make the play. It’s not like you take two steps if you’re a defensive lineman and say, ‘well you know what, I’ve done my job.’” That’s not true in this defense and this being said, you’re talking about 300 pound guys you want to sprint. They’re not built to do that so there will be a rotation you’ll see when the season starts including six guys and maybe seven.”

Q: So that it’s not a demotion?

EDWARDS: “No there’s no demotion. When you talk about starters – especially on our defense – you’ll realize right away especially with the inside guys like the linemen and the interior guys that they are going to rotate. Now, on the program you’ve got to list 11 guys, but at the end of the day when you count the reps a lot of those guys will have an equal amount of reps. They’re all going to play and that’s why it’s important for some of our starters to get in shape. We’re getting them more reps in practice because in the pre-season games, as you know, they don’t play a lot. And, if you don’t play your starters a lot they’re going to get out of shape.”

Q: How’s Casey Printers looking in practice?

EDWARDS: “He’s doing OK. He practices well and now what he has to do is apply what we’re asking him to do in practice on the field. In Minnesota he got a little out of whack but he’s a talented guy, got a strong arm, is a knowledgeable kid and wants to learn. It’s good to have and as the pre-season goes it’ll be fun to watch him cause he’s going to make a lot of plays.”

Q: What about Brodie Croyle getting back today?

EDWARDS: “He’s not ready to throw full-out yet. We’ll just manage him day to day.”

Q: Any idea when Michael Bennett will come back?

EDWARDS: “Probably won’t play this week. Probably next week he’ll be in the fray. He’ll probably do some individual stuff at most, but not a whole lot. A hamstring (strain) and we’re going to baby it; we don’t want the guy to come out and tear his hamstring and then it’s a real problem.”

Q: You talked all last week about a backup running back and he appears to be your guy. Doesn’t he give you capabilities that you didn’t have?

EDWARDS: “Yeah, because he’s a speed guy who can break the big run. He’s different than the guys that we have.”

Q: Does that mean you can expand your playbook a little bit?

EDWARDS: “Yeah, but it’s a matter of plays. We’re going to have to put a package in him for when Larry needs a blow. That’s understandable. But our main thing is to get our young players caught up right now with what we want to do. He’s going to be a guy that’s going to have to learn our offense. It’s a big playbook.”

Q: You had yesterday off, so why did you give so many players the morning off?

EDWARDS: “Because some of them are one-a-day. Some will come back this afternoon. We know who they are and we schedule it that way. We’ve talked about it. Turley had a (morning) off today but he’ll come back this afternoon.”

Q: Is Craphonso Thorpe’s injury…..

EDWARDS: “He’s got a shoulder; he’s got to get well. I don’t know him because I haven’t been here long. He’s been a little bit nicked. But Maxy’s come back and Hodge, too. That’s good and we signed Shane Burton who was with me in New York at inside tackle. We were down on inside guys and he’s got a chance.”

Q: Anything new on the Brian Waters front?

EDWARDS: “He’s out this week for sure. I don’t anticipate him playing this week or next.”

Q: Have you talked to Willie Roaf yet?

EDWARDS: “I haven’t talked to him. I know he’s out of the country yet. I always say be patient. I was pretty patient with Ty Law and it all sort of worked out.”

Q: Who has impressed you from your young guys?

EDWARDS: “I think the safeties have kind of shown they’ve got something to them. I think Jeff Webb has a lot of potential and some young linebackers who have done a good job. Our first pick will be a pretty good player. He’s got a great motor. What we saw in college he shows he can do here, too. We’ll see how the season goes.

“I think Dee Brown is having a good camp. I saw something I needed to see against Minnesota. I saw some toughness. He’s a smart, dependable guy you can trust. I like him.”

Q: It seems you like you have a lot of interior linemen in there?

EDWARDS: “You’ve got to create competition and that’s how your players get better. I believe that and I think that’s how your players get better and your football team gets better, too. They’ve got to compete; they’ve got to work every day. No one’s making this team on default. I told them that. They’re not going to make the team on default. Whoever you are you are.

“At that position we’ve got some guys nicked. We went into Minnesota with only eight defensive linemen. In the preseason you can’t have eight defensive linemen and survive it. We need more guys there and we have some guys who are nicked and that puts all the burden on the guys that are working. You wear those guys out. Our tempo is not going to slow down. And when those new DB’s showed up today you had another pair of fresh legs. That’s more reps for them and less for the others.”

Q: John Browning wasn’t out there today.

EDWARDS: “He’s got a back (problem). He’s out for at least six weeks. We’ll see what happens.”

Q: Is that one of the reasons you brought Burton in?

EDWARDS: “Yeah, cause (Browning’s) hurt and we lost an interior guy. Generally, you dress seven (defensive linemen). If it’s real hot opening day and you play a team that passes a lot then you’ll dress eight because of what you’re asking them to do. You never know how many you’re going to dress. I’ve always done it that way. No doubt about it.”

Q: What do you remember about Burton?

EDWARDS: “Very, very tough guy, smart guy. Plays well with his hands. The year I was with him he had about six batted balls. It was kind of amazing. He does a great job of getting his hands up and knock balls down.”

Q: With Kyle Turley being gone from the game for two years, do you see him trying to find that mean streak when he played?

EDWARDS: “I don’t think that left. When you’re mean you’re mean. You don’t lose that. You got mean grandparents, they’re old and they’re still mean. I don’t think he lost that. He’s a tough guy and a mentally tough guy. For a guy who’s been out for two years he’s doing a good job of working his way back into shape. He’s a guy we’ve got to watch, too, because he’s a guy who won’t rest and you’ve got to protect him a little bit.”

Q: Is he a much more mature player?

EDWARDS: “No doubt about it. It ain’t even close and he’s been out of football for two years and that helps. Sitting on the couch and watching you say, ‘I’m still young; I can play this game.’ He missed it. He really did.”
